Are you a Chemist or Materials Expert with a passion for ensuring the material compliance and driving sustainability initiatives and practices within the materials and product development processes?
If so, we have an exciting opportunity for you! Join our team within the High Voltage Products sector, where you will play a pivotal role in ensuring the compliance and sustainability of products such as High Voltage Switchgear, Power Quality Products, Insulation Components, and Control and Monitoring solutions.
Our flexible work practices help you optimize personal and business performance while creating an environment where all employees can develop their skills and grow.
Your responsibilities
Monitor and assess regulations and standards relevant to our product portfolios sustainability and compliance.
Utilize your material and chemistry background and contribute to material compliance related customer discussions.
Lead projects and activities within Hitachi Energy addressing material compliance and sustainability of the product portfolio.
Drive continuous improvement processes including audit and oversight mechanisms related to materials selection, testing, sustainability, and compliance.
Create and maintain the appropriate internal guidelines, processes and policies for product qualification, testing, sustainability, and compliance.
Close collaboration with scientists and engineers from Hitachi Energy research, development centers and external laboratories and service providers around the world in material selection, specification, and qualification.
Interface with procurement and quality engineers to support supplier selection and qualification.
Your background
PhD, master’s degree or equivalent degree (university of applied science/university) in chemistry, chemical engineering, materials science, or closely related subject.
Knowledge of global regulations including REACH, RoHS, EU WFD, TSCA, Conflict Minerals.
Working knowledge in project management is an asset.
Team player with excellent communication skills.
Fluency in English, basic German skills, or willingness to learn German.
Willingness to travel (5-10%).
